Output 864b62078fe610ce107ec8fd4203c03d4274eaa19d67e4460809505b3cb48296:1

value
1643786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86fd306d9f0f93089fd6be5fa65b1bf3a8c44f09 OP_EQUAL
address
3Dzmn996hZkPZw9Tm3J4zDMxZEDjQSNcM5
transaction
864b62078fe610ce107ec8fd4203c03d4274eaa19d67e4460809505b3cb48296
confirmations
398515
spent
true